The idea
The drawing and the spreadsheet always disagree.
In most MEP workflows the drawing and the engineering live apart. Duct sizes are worked out in a spreadsheet, typed onto a drawing, and then drift as the design changes. engiCAD keeps the geometry, the system topology and the calculation in one place, so a change to the layout re-sizes the run, updates the schedule and moves the cost.
2D in, 3D out
Draw in plan. Get a 3D model.
The interface is the 2D plan view every building-services engineer already knows. There is no 3D modelling to learn and no team to retrain — the third dimension comes from the data you were entering anyway, and it is what makes the calculations and schedules possible.
- Author in 2D — draw services in plan with the drafting tools and shortcuts you already use.
- Elevations do the rest — levels, offsets and gradients give every run its true height; risers connect floors.
- A real 3D model — every element you place appears in it: ductwork and pipework, plant, terminals, boards and accessories, luminaires, detectors and cameras, walls and spaces — including the element types you create yourself.
- Walk through it — a 3D view with first-person navigation for checking coordination before it reaches site.
Disciplines
Every service, side by side.
Not just drawn in one file: every service works from the same levels, spaces and model data, so what one discipline enters, the next can use.
Ventilation & HVAC
Ductwork with automatic sizing, terminals, plant, fire dampers and index-run pressure analysis.
Ventilation design →Air conditioning & VRF
VRF and split pipework, unit pairing, copper line sizing, piping limits and F-Gas charge.
VRF design →Plumbing & hot water
Loading units under four demand codes, pipe sizing, hot-water return loops with pump head.
Plumbing design →Drainage
Discharge units accumulated per branch to BS EN 12056-2, stack assignment and gradients.
Drainage design →Electrical, data & ELV
Circuits, distribution boards, derated cable sizing, structured cabling, lighting and CCTV.
Electrical design →Controls & containment
BMS control panels and device links, with user-defined containment types routed and counted like any other service.
What it does
Design, measure and issue.
Calculations & sizing
Darcy–Weisbach duct sizing, four water demand codes, BS EN 12056-2 drainage, HWR pump head, EnergyPlus loads, psychrometrics and illuminance.
See the solvers →Quantities & BOQ
Take-off measured from the model with waste margins and stock lengths, a numbered bill with builder's work, Excel export and traceability back to the drawing.
See the take-off →Working with DWG
Open DWG and DXF directly as editable geometry or a coordination underlay, with the full modify toolset and reload when the architect reissues.
See interchange →The model & 3D
Typed objects with instance and type parameters, parametric groups that carry a change through, and building context — levels, spaces and occupancy — that feeds the calculations.
See the model →Your projects
Open today's job on any machine.
Projects live encrypted in your own engiCAD cloud space. Sign in from the office desktop, a laptop on site or a machine you've never used before, and the work is there — along with the drawing references it depends on.
Any machine
Sign in and your projects are there, in folders you can organise, move and copy to start the next job.
Version history
Browse earlier versions of a project and restore one. A bad afternoon costs you an afternoon rather than the job.
Underlays travel too
The DWG and DXF references a project depends on sync alongside it, so a project opened elsewhere isn't missing its background.
Works offline
Lose the connection and a cloud project still opens from the copy on your machine, underlays included.
Encrypted
Project files are encrypted and integrity-checked, and move over HTTPS.
Crashes cost nothing
Background recovery snapshots run while you work, so an unsaved hour survives a crash or a stray reboot.
On teams: cloud projects belong to your account. engiCAD does not yet support two people editing one project at the same time, or sharing a project between accounts — so treat it as your own work following you between machines, not a shared workspace.
